This document presents the different steps to follow in order to

calculate a flash at a fixed temperature and pressure for a

mixture of water and ethanol, in a Excel spreadsheet.

The steps are the following:

Step 1: Creating a Simulis object in a spreadsheet

Step 2: Managing the unit system

Step 3: Selecting the compounds

Step 4: Selecting the thermodynamic model

Step 5: Building functions in the spreadsheet

The function will return mass or

molar composition of the liquid

(xl), and vapor (yv) phases, and

the equilibrium constants (ki) for

all compounds (in our case, we

will get six values).

Key in the function parameters

and press simultaneously

Ctrl+Shift+Enter to return a

vector in the results cells you

selected (see user’s guide)
